Output 26d3089c4e04175f7ad311ad641212e927e38201dec36b56c267ad08a4612e5c:6

value
127692884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8444b25949a2dc3620a041c54b9d92cfd6e01fc1 OP_EQUAL
address
MKxXit276G1juuzz41RwYfmZJYmrb2ipYQ
transaction
26d3089c4e04175f7ad311ad641212e927e38201dec36b56c267ad08a4612e5c
spent
true